The NuPAGE 4–12% Bis-Tris gel is a pre-cast polyacrylamide gel used for the separation of proteins in electrophoresis. It has a gradient of 4% to 12% acrylamide concentration, which allows for the separation of a wide range of protein molecular weights.

Quantitative Analysis of Tau Protein in AD

Check if the same lab product or an alternative is used in the 5 most similar protocols
Preparation of brain homogenates, Western blot (WB) and Dot blot (DB) analysis were performed as previously described30 (link),62 (link). Briefly, 0.2 g of brain tissue from four different AD cases were homogenized in 0.4 ml TBS buffer with Halt™ Protease and Phosphatase Inhibitor Cocktail (100X, Thermo Scientific, CA), then centrifuged at 6400xg for 15 minutes at +4 °C. Supernatants (soluble fractions) were collected and stored at −80 °C for further analysis. For WB soluble fractions applied to electrophoresis on NuPAGE 4–12% Bis-Tris gel in MES buffer under reducing conditions (Invitrogen, CA) and electrotransferred onto nitrocellulose membrane (GE Healthcare, NJ). Tau were visualized by incubating with sera (dilution at 1:1000) from mice immunized with AV-1980R/A and injected with AdvaxCpG only followed by HRP-conjugated anti-mouse IgG (Santa Cruz Biotechnology, CA). For DB assay the same extracts were applied to membrane (1 μg). Proteins were detected using sera from mice immunized with AV-1980R/A and control mice injected with AdvaxCpG only, TNT-1 (Millipore, MA), HT7 (Life Technology, CA) antibodies. All primary antibodies were used at concentration of 1 μg/ml, serum was used at dilution 1:2500. Bovine anti-mouse HRP-conjugated secondary antibody was used (Santa Cruz Biotechnology, CA).

Tau Protein Analysis in Alzheimer's Disease Brain

Check if the same lab product or an alternative is used in the 5 most similar protocols
Preparation of brain homogenates from AD cases and Western blot (WB) analysis were performed as previously described[37 (link)]. Briefly, 0.2g of brain tissue from four different AD cases were homogenized in 0.4ml TBS buffer with Halt Protease and Phosphatase Inhibitor Cocktail (100X, Thermo Scientific, CA), then centrifuged at 6400xg for 15 minutes at +4°C. Supernatants were collected and applied to electrophoresis on NuPAGE 4–12% Bis-Tris gel in MES buffer under reducing conditions (Invitrogen, CA) and electrotransferred onto nitrocellulose membrane (GE Healthcare, NJ). Tau were visualized by incubating with sera from mice immunized with AV-1980D and pMultiTEP followed by HRP-conjugated anti-mouse IgG (Santa Cruz Biotechnology, CA). Anti-Tau (TNT-1; EMD Millipore, CA) monoclonal antibody was used as positive control.
